CHARLOTTE ELAINE BEAUMONT was born sometime in 1948 and although she didn't have an exact month, date or time, she couldn't be any happier.

Her life story was not what someone would deem as a happy one. She grew up an orphan and without parents but the children's home in Lyon was well-maintained by a wonderful woman by the name of Alice Lamoree and her philanthropist husband, Gale. The pair loved all the orphaned children that roamed their historic home in the 5th arrondissement but to Charlotte they were so much more and one of the few people to know about her secret "trick".

It had been quite a shock for Mr and Mrs. Lamoree to find Charlotte's favorite stuffed tiger turn into her favorite storybook at the age of seven. But despite the oddness they kept her "trick" a secret and monitored it in an orderly fashion which Charlotte was eternally grateful for.

What more could she say? Charlotte Beaumont had a beautiful but oddly strange life. She had a best friend, Mr and Mrs. Lamoree's daughter, Marie. She could fold reality to her will, turn vegetables to chocolate and milk to lemonade. At the age of sixteen she would ride bikes by the riverside of Presqu'ile with Marie and they'd flirt with the boys who caught their eyes and laugh over croissants and scones. At the age of eighteen, she would move out of the children's house and go to college in the city where she'd study physics and philosophy, teaching herself in the way of her powers. She had a small apartment in the 2nd arrondissement and life was good.

Charlotte's life passed on and over the decades she enjoyed it as best as she could. She saw concerts and plays at the theater with Marie. She had a small number of lovers though none ever seemed to feel the way it should. She wouldn't let this bother her, instead dedicating her time to her studies and the magic of the city she resided. She made outstanding contributions to science, to research. She taught classes on quantum physics, theories and reality. Her students loved her and she loved them.

It was almost as though she were living out some dream.

It was beautiful but something always felt missing.

Lost.

Now, in the year 2002, Charlotte Beaumont was the ripe age of fifty four as she walked through the Parc de la Tete d'Or for one of the numerous times throughout her existence. The wind rustled the trees and she could hear the muffled voices of conversation and happy laughter. All this created a beautiful daydream that was disrupted by a sharp and present jolt as a boy passed by in the park.

She didn't know why he stuck out to her in such a way but his presence was captivating in a headache inducing way. His cloudy eyes were trained on hers for a brief moment before turning away almost indistinguishable. Neat, combed back hair and knee high socks. A schoolboy.

The headache ensued and Charlotte felt her fingers reach her temple. The little grains of reality appeared in front of her, threatening to bend to her will if she loosened. Charlotte closed her eyes, focusing on making the possibilities disappear. She turned around and gasped as she came face to face with Marie, her thinning brown hair and brown eyes cold and serious compared to the warm smile on her face.

"What are you doing here? I thought you had work." she mumbled, headache worsening slowly, particles disappearing.

"Change of plans." was the only response given as Marie dragged her away and out of the park, the boy disappearing from view.
